Donation of used pram by doylet in brisbane

[–]Sensitive-Base-9119 2 points3 points  (0 children)

They also take donations at the children’s hospital for prams. Lots of babies are in there for months at a time and having a pram on the ward helps facilitate parents being able to get them outside or take them for laps around the hospital. Lots of families also fly in from different places in the state so don’t have access to prams during this time.

Stays near antwerp station by StrengthOk2052 in Tomorrowland

[–]Sensitive-Base-9119 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Perfectly safe to stay near the station is right in the city centre. I would recommend anywhere within 5-10 min walk so you don’t have too far to walk back at the end of the night. Have personally stayed at Park Inn by Radisson (literally next door to the station) and Theater hotel and recommend both.
